Abstract

Abstract We discuss existence and multiplicity of positive solutions of the Dirichlet problem for the quasilinear ordinary differential equation . Depending on the behaviour of f = f (t, s) near s = 0, we prove the existence of either one, or two, or three, or infinitely many positive solutions. In general, the positivity of f is not required. All results are obtained by reduction to an equivalent non-singular problem to which variational or topological methods apply in a classical fashion.
